How to join the clerics?

Head to Hort, located in the upper right corner of the map. Go to the territory of the city and look for a fortress in its far part (the image of a "fortress" above the main entrance to the building), in which Reinhold is located. Talk to him on all topics and say that you want to join the clerics.

Complete his "Night Adventures" quest, then find Dietrich and complete his "Supplier" quest.


Indeed, to join the clerics, it is enough to complete only these two quests, which we described in detail in another section:

  • Night adventures.
  • Provider.

Which faction to choose?

It is impossible to unequivocally answer which faction will be correct and best. It all depends on your preferences. There are three factions in the game - Berserkers, Clerics and Outcasts. Each of the factions has unique features and skills that will enhance one or another style of play. Think in advance which faction you want to choose for further play.


You can't change factions from one to another!

Berserkers

"Berserkers" will reward you with access to various magic spells, but at the same time, according to its laws, it is forbidden to use firearms, modern weapons. Of the unique abilities of this faction, I would like to note the summoning of ghosts, the rapid recovery of wounds and the increase in damage.


Berserkers can enchant weapons - enchantment can only be applied to old axes, hammers or swords. You can also shoot multiple arrows at once (but only with a bow). In this way, you can create a melee character who uses spells and his bow to power up.

  • Faction City : Goliet.
  • Leader : Ragnar.
  • Unique weapons : axes, swords, blades.
  • Armor "Berserkers" : the armor of the farmer, the armor of the warrior and the armor of the paladin.

General faction abilities :

  • "Berserk" is the standard skill of the faction, which will grant accessto all other abilities. If you have it, you will be able to communicate with trainers, purchase the necessary armor sets and use mana. It is this skill that affects the ability to improve magical weapons and increase resistance to poisoning.
  • "Magic" will increase spell damage and duration.
  • "Mana" with each new level will increase the total amount of mana that is needed to activate various spells.
  • Enchanting Weapons will help you set up enchantments that increase damage. The higher the ability, the better.
  • Scatter Shot allows you to fire multiple arrows at the same time.
  • "Self-guided arrow" (everything is clear from the name).

All spells "Berserkers" :

  • "Camouflage" when activated, reduces the likelihood that you will be detected by opponents.
  • "Leather Armor" will increase the durability of your armor.
  • Aspect of the Warrior will increase the damage of melee weapons.
  • Blood Transfusion will allow you to restore your mana at the expense of HP reduction.
  • Summon Wolf allows you to summon a wolf spirit to fight for you in battle.
  • "Feeling of Life" highlights all enemies, neutral and friendly characters located nearby.
  • Poison Aura is an AoE damage spell that allows you to attack with poison on one or anotherareas.
  • "Heal" will allow you to restore the HP of Jax and your own allies.

outcasts

The characters of this faction predominantly use rifles that fire regular bullets, and not plasma (like clerics). In addition, representatives of this faction use special workbenches to produce weapons. Outcasts have a huge number of skills that are used during crafting - in the manufacture of weapons, ammunition. This faction is the only faction that can produce and use preps that provide certain bonuses.

In addition, after joining the Outcasts, you will be able to dismantle any weapon into parts. These parts are either sold or used to make other equipment.

  • Faction City : Fort
  • Leader : William.
  • Unique weapons : junk weapons, etc.
  • Unique Armor : Courier Armor, Brute Armor, and Captain's Set.

Basic faction abilities :

  • Outcast is a standard faction skill that unlocks all others. Once you have it, you can interact with Forsworn trainers and learn new skills, as well as purchase courier equipment and other ranks (when you level it up). Also, the skill will help improve weapons and increase radiation resistance. In addition, you will lose the penalty that you would receive if you used preps without joining a faction (reduction in experience gained). Finally, you can use multiple preps at the same time.
  • "Disassembly" will help you disassemble any weapon into its component components. These components are either sold or used for crafting.
  • “Ammunition Crafting” speaks for itself (we are talking about ammunition for firearms using powder bullets).
  • "Body Chemistry" with each level will increase the duration and effect of the use of preps. A sort of alternative to the "Magic" of the berserkers.
  • The Low Tech Weapons Master will unlock the workbench and craft weapons used by the Forsworn.
  • "Stock of preps" with each new level will increase the maximum possible number of preps that you can use at the same time.

All skills related to the Outcasts preps:

  • "Overdose" will allowprepare a prep that increases the recovery process of HP.
  • Steelskin will increase your armor and resistance to all types of damage for a short time.
  • Punch Me will allow you to do a prep that will temporarily increase your attack and block speed.
  • The Chemistry Scanner will allow you to create a special stimulant that temporarily increases the visibility range of simple objects.
  • Fortify Immunity will make a prep that temporarily increases resistance to all effects, including fire, poison, ice, and radiation.
  • Tough Guy will allow you to create a prep that temporarily increases resistance to any damage.
  • Mind Switch creates a prep that temporarily increases damage dealt by 100%.
  • Animal Lover creates a prep that temporarily scares some animals away from Jax (does not work on strong monsters!).

Clerics

Clerics are a faction that allows you to use energy-type ranged weapons. These weapons fire either energy or plasma projectiles. In addition, you will have the opportunity to use psi-skills, partially similar to the magic of "Berserkers". Psi-skills are associated with the ability to launch energy waves, teleport over short distances, or create holograms.

  • Faction City : Hort.
  • Leader: Reinhold.
  • Unique weapons : psi booster, psi helmet, flamethrowers, swords, laser rifles and energy shields.
  • Unique Armor : Acolyte Armor, Legate Set, Regent Armor.

Basic faction abilities :

  • The main skill is called Cleric. It is it that opens access to the rest of the branches, provides the opportunity to interact with trainers, buy various armor and use psi abilities. Also, the skill opens up the possibility of improving energy guns and increases resistance to fire.
  • "Psi" with each new level increases the damage and duration of various psi skills.
  • "Battery" (charge) for each level will increase the amount of psi-energy used to activate psi-skills.
  • The High-Tech Weapons Master will allow you to craft faction-unique weapons that fire energy/plasma projectiles.
  • "One man in the field" will increase the damage dealt with any weapon in the event that you move without a companion.
  • "IN?"convincing" will allow you to use unique dialogue branches that allow you to persuade different characters.

Psi-abilities of the Clerics :

  • Technophile will allow you to activate a skill that will illuminate all nearby enemies made from synthetic materials, as well as all high-tech equipment.
  • "Purge" allows you to get rid of any negative effects that have been placed on Jax.
  • Force Shield will create an energy field around Jax, protecting him from incoming damage.
  • Unity with Weapons, when activated, greatly increases the damage of high-tech ranged weapons.
  • "Teleportation", if activated, will allow you to move over short distances, leaving a hologram of Jax in place of the previous location, distracting opponents.
  • Energy Wave will create a burst of energy, dealing damage to all enemies in range.
  • The Last Stand unlocks a skill that, if killed, will revive Jax with half of his maximum HP.
  • "Projection" will allow you to create a hologram that diverts the attention of all opponents.

How to save the game?

Unfortunately, even after several patches have been released, some Elex playersface a challenge in maintaining their achievements. For example, the game crashes, or after a normal restart, it turns out that the “Continue” and “Download” buttons are simply not available, as if there were no save files on the computer at all. Gamers have no choice but to start a New Game.

In fact, saves from the computer do not go anywhere. They are still on your PC, it's just that the game itself loses contact with them. In order to deal with the problem, you need to go to the game settings and get into the mount_packed.xml file located in the data / ini folder. In fact, this is a standard text file that can be opened using basic Notepad or one of the other editors (Notepad ++ has a special advantage). In the latter case, all the syntax used in xml files will be highlighted, and you will be able to quickly navigate through the settings.

Having opened this file, you will need to specify a link to the location where the saves are stored. This folder can be found through the search bar if you enter the query SaveGames. Move to the correct directory, which should ideally be on your hard drive, and then look for the following data:

CreateFolder="true"

VirtualPath="save"

PhysicalPath = "$(savedgames)/ELEX/SaveGames"

Opposite the PhysicalPath parameter, you should set the address of the save folder, where they are located. After that, you will get rid of the accessibility problem.

What is coldness (how to know)?

As conceived by the developers, "Coldness" Jax allows you to show the gamer how the main character is human or synthetic. Jax was once in the ranks of the Albs, a faction that consumes elex on a daily basis, thanks to which its members become much stronger, but completely lose all their emotions. From the very beginning of the game, you will notice that Jax does not show any feelings, talking with other people as concisely as possible and exclusively on business.

At the beginning of the game, "Coldness" will be neutral (zero), but in almost every dialogue and decision made, this parameter will increase or decrease. This includes both story and side quests. Keeping track of "coldness" is not so easy, because the developers have hidden from us all its possible digital manifestations. You can see Jax's trait which indicates what level it is??n his coldness.

From the coldness will depend on how other characters relate to GG. Basically, it's still the same reputation system used in other RPGs. A scoundrel will never be warmly welcomed by the people, nor will a decent guy by bandits.

Remember once and for all:

  • A decrease in coldness leads to a good outlook.
  • The increase in coldness makes Jax callous.

The main coldness changes will occur during dialogue branches with various characters. But if in such projects as Mass Effect and Dragon Age good and bad phrases were highlighted right when selected in the dialog box, then in Elex there are no such designations. However, in most cases, the lower replicas lead to a decrease in the morale of the hero, that is, increase the coldness.

If you do not set yourself the rules of behavior, then coldness will constantly jump from side to side. It is best to choose in advance who you want to be - a human or an insensitive robot.

You will need to save before each conversation so that in cases where the answers do not suit your worldview, you can easily reload and click on another cue. And here we are talking about phrases that lower silt?? that increase Jax's reputation for this character, as well as about the lines that affect the coldness.

How is coldness related to the plot?

At the beginning of the game it will seem that this parameter does not really affect anything, but very soon you will understand how it relates to the game world. For example, during dialogues, lines will begin to appear that require high or low coldness, while the surrounding characters will begin to treat Jax better or worse.

Thus, acting at random in dialogues is not recommended - it is best to stick to one given reference point from the very beginning of the game. In the future, you will be able to put pressure on various characters.

Also, the coldness is associated with the ending of the game. There are three of them, and you can get it in case of high, neutral or low coldness.

Not every dialogue phrase affects coldness. In the event that the parameter is changed, a corresponding notification appears on the screen. Drinking any Elex you have prepared increases your coldness by 0.1 units.

From the list below you will find out the digital values of coldness. You also need to remember that the character becomes emotional after the coldness drops below 20 units, neutral - 40-60, and synthetic - from 80 and above. To the beginninge games your coldness is equal to 50 points!

  • Fully emotional - 0 units.
  • Expressive - 0-10 units.
  • Irrational - 11-20 units.
  • Spontaneous - 21-30 units.
  • Intuitive - 31-40 units.
  • Neutral - 41-59 units.
  • Insensitive - 60-69 units.
  • Sentimental - 70-79 units.
  • Logical - 80-89 units.
  • Icy Calm - 90-99 units.
  • Synthetic - 100 units.

There is one notable error. If your coldness is equal to any value ending in "9", then the game may erroneously indicate a "fully emotional" state. For example, we are talking about 29, 59, etc.

Ka?? dig ore?

In order to mine ore, you will need a jackhammer. You can find one of these either in the pit with the berserk weapons, under Goliet, or in the gorge near the Outcast Fort. In addition, some merchants offer a hammer in their assortment.

As for the skill, it will only affect how many minerals you mine in a certain amount of time. You can mine ore even without this skill, if you have a jackhammer.

How to enchant a weapon?

To begin with, you must join the berserkers, and then purchase the "Enchant" ability from one of the trainers. It should be understood that the ability associated with the ability to install gems is a completely different mechanic. This requires skill and a workbench.

Only melee weapons can be enchanted. This mechanic is akin to modifying firearms, high-tech cleric weapons. Enchanting requires the weapon to be upgraded at least once (attachedrate I, II or III). Enchanting melee berserk weapons will allow you to convert physical damage into poison, fire, or whatever. When you hit with an enchanted weapon, you additionally impose a debuff on the enemy.

If you level up the weapon at the workbench, the enchantment will disappear. You will have to reapply it. Unique weapons cannot be upgraded or enchanted!!! You also cannot enchant any ranged weapons.

How to hack correctly?

So, at the beginning of the hack, a kind of mini-game will begin, the purpose of which is to move the bolts inside the chest in the correct order. After that, the chest will open. Pay attention to what color these pins are (you will see this when they are raised). You need to make sure that these pins are blue.

To get started, find two identical pins that remain blue after picking up. Move the cursor to the right side to slide the lockpick in, and then find the pins you need.

After picking up the two blue pins, move the lockpick under the first one, which is located to the left of this pair. If it is blue, then you have chosen the right path. If two blue pins fall and turn red, then the sequence is wrong. In this case, you need to raise the blue pair again, and then select the pin not to the left, but to the right of it.

Thus, gradually, lifting one pin after another, you will find the correct combination. But the higher the protection of the lock, the more difficult it will be to break. Several blue pairs can appear in them at once. In this case, you need to use the above method, applying it first for the first pair, and after that for the second.

How to join the Outcasts?

Head to the Fort, located slightly to the right and above the center of the map. This place is the capital of outcasts. After going inside in any way, move along the right border and find William's small tent. Be careful - quests for joining a faction, as well as directly accepting a rogue, are issued by William, and not by the Duke in the far tower.

The quest associated with joining the Outcasts is called "Desert Vultures". Talk to William, then take the Fragile Power quest from him. As part of this quest, you will need to complete several others:

  • "On behalf of the family" take from Big Jim in the far right of the Fort.
  • Commonwealth of the Poor is activated by Chloe in the bar.
  • "Waiting for the Rat" (Fresh Blood) - is activated if you took the side of the Rat in a conflict with Blake.
  • "Help the Garbage Baron" will be another quest from Big Jim.

How to enter Hort?

At the entrance to Hort, the capital of the clerics, you will be met by Xander. You will learn that not everyone is allowed to enter the Hort territory. There are several ways to get inside:

  • Buy a trade permit.
  • Find Reiner located in Abessa and talk to him about recruiting clerics.
  • Bribe Xander - he will return the money you give, but will allow you to enter for one loan. Xander asks that you blame a certain character (who is not actually a smuggler) for everything in the investigation.

A Trade Permit is sold at the Levin trader, located near the entrance to Hort near the battle colossus. He will give you a quest, within which you will literally need to walk a little, defeat monsters and collect supplies.

How to attack with a satchel?

Jetpack attack is a separate skill called "Reactive Attack".

Is it required at the first level?? 50 dexterity and 30 intelligence, as well as one skill point and 500 shards.

To learn this skill, you will need a martial arts teacher. These are:

  • Kormag in Goliet.
  • Hagen in Hort.
  • Big Jim from the Fort.
  • Jonesy in Istok.

This skill can only be used with a melee weapon while close to an enemy. To do this, fly into the sky, and then perform a powerful attack - LMB and E. One such attack completely depletes the energy supply in the jetpack, and it is quite difficult to execute it.

What to do with Conrad?

Conrad is connected to one of the Elex story quests. Head to the Fort and talk to the outcasts. In the Duke's fortress, in its lower part, look for Konrad. However, to unlock the task, it is enough to talk with the Duke. Offer him your help. The task is connected with the completion of the assembly of a huge bomb, which the outcasts are going to use to conquer the world.

After you activate the task, go to Konrad and find out what parts are left to find. A total of three components are required. You can scare Conrad, pay him, or just ask where to look for these details. It doesn't matter in what order you collect them.

Look for the first component on the territory of the military base, located west of the motel and northwest of the Fort. The base is surrounded by minesand so you have to be careful. Yes, and on its territory there are dangers - a huge number of strong monsters. Go inside the main building and use the jetpack to climb up through the hole in the ceiling. Collect the component to get 400 experience.

In search of the second part, head north from the Fort. You will find yourself near a huge destroyed dome, in which there are mutants. Kill them or try to pick up the part as quickly as possible, and then leave this place - another 400 experience points.

The third part is located in a spacious factory to the west of the Fort. The best way to approach it is from Goliet. Look around the factory, kill the enemies and use the jetpack to get into the room with a huge level of radiation. Take the part and get another 400 experience.

Once all these components are collected, then run to Konrad and give them to him. You will receive another 2000 experience points. Go to the Duke and report that the construction of the bomb is completed.

Finding Conrad

Leave the Fort and move north towards the ruins. Kill enemies along the way. Eventually, you will come close to another ruined dome. Once there, you will be credited with 400 experience. Before heading down to the battlefield, save and equip the best weapons right?Light combat - Plasma or laser rifles will come in handy. Once you're inside, you'll find out that instead of a bomb, Konrad has assembled a Badabuma, a huge robotic machine. You will have to fight it yourself, even if you have a companion.

As soon as the battle starts, try not to run towards the robot. Hide from his attacks using various objects as cover. Watch out for the powerful ground slam that Badabuma does periodically. Wait for the moment when a small robot appears. He will immediately begin to collect Elex, and after that he will repair Badabuma in case of damage. Attack this mini robot with a ranged weapon or close range if it lands on the ground. Stay on the move as the Badabuma will scatter explosives at these times.

After destroying the repair drone, you will receive 250 experience, but the second stage of the battle will begin. From now on, Badabuma will start using the flamethrower. If there is no armor or skills that increase fire resistance, then try to stay as far away from the enemy as possible. Use ranged attacks to weaken him. By defeating the enemy, you will receive 2500 experience points.

Follow back to the Fort, into the bunker and talk to the Duke. The quest will end with 2000 experience, but the Duke will ask you to find and kill??t Conrad.

You can find him in the city of clerics, in Hort. Look for Konrad in the factory area. First, talk to the man. If you want to complete the Duke's task, then attack and kill Konrad. Get 1100 experience. Go back to the Duke and turn in the quest to get an additional reward - 3000 shards.

Note. If you kill Konrad, then significantly lower the attitude of the clerics and put on the line joining this faction.
